Advertisement

Quiverc:依据矢量长度生成带色彩箭头的箭袋图-MATLAB开发

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
Quiverc是一款基于MATLAB开发的功能工具,它能依据向量长度绘制带有颜色编码的箭头,形成独特的箭袋图,有效增强数据可视化效果。 这是 CM Thompson 提供的函数 quiver 的一个修改版本,用于在点 (x,y) 处绘制速度向量箭头,其分量为 (u,v),颜色对应于向量大小,并使用当前的颜色图。提示:为了获得最佳效果,请在该函数后添加 set(gcf, InvertHardCopy, off) 以保持硬拷贝上的黑色背景。请参见附件中的示例。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• Quiverc-MATLAB
    优质
    Quiverc是一款基于MATLAB开发的功能工具,它能依据向量长度绘制带有颜色编码的箭头,形成独特的箭袋图,有效增强数据可视化效果。 这是 CM Thompson 提供的函数 quiver 的一个修改版本,用于在点 (x,y) 处绘制速度向量箭头,其分量为 (u,v),颜色对应于向量大小,并使用当前的颜色图。提示:为了获得最佳效果,请在该函数后添加 set(gcf, InvertHardCopy, off) 以保持硬拷贝上的黑色背景。请参见附件中的示例。
  • 查看器 文件预览 预览
    优质
    这款工具提供便捷的矢量箭头文件预览功能,支持多种格式箭头文件查看与编辑。轻松实现高效办公需求。 Arrow查看器用于预览Arrow文件和Vector Arrow文件。
  • 200个标集
    优质
    本资源包包含200个高质量矢量箭头图标,适用于网页设计、UI界面和图形项目。每个图标均采用SVG格式,方便缩放且不失真,色彩丰富多样,可轻松融入各类创意作品中。 矢量箭头图标是设计领域中的常见元素,在UI设计、网页设计、信息图表及演示文稿中有广泛应用。它们简洁直观的特点能够有效引导用户视线,指示方向或表达流程。“200个矢量箭头图标”资源包提供了多种不同类型的箭头设计,满足设计师在各种场景下的需求。 矢量图标的优点在于其无限的缩放能力,与像素图像相比,在放大时不会失真。这确保了这些箭头图标无论是在手机屏幕上还是大型广告上使用都能保持清晰锐利的边缘效果。此外,矢量格式(如SVG)通常比位图格式(如PNG、JPEG)占用的空间更小,这对网站加载速度和移动应用性能都有积极影响。 该资源包中的200个箭头图标可能涵盖了各种风格、形状与颜色选项,以适应不同的设计主题及用途。例如,它们包括直线箭头、曲线箭头、双向箭头等类型,并且每种类型的大小和角度也有所不同,以便于指向不同方向的需求。这些图标还分为多种类别如基本箭头、流程图箭头及指示器箭头等等,方便设计师快速找到合适的样式。 在设计项目中,矢量箭头图标可用于创建导航菜单、指示按钮等元素,在网页设计中则常用于指示滚动或链接跳转等功能;而在信息图表和演示文稿场景下,则有助于传达数据变化趋势与因果关系。为了充分利用这些图标资源,设计师需要掌握相应的矢量编辑软件(如Adobe Illustrator 或Inkscape),并了解如何将其导出为Web友好的格式(如SVG、PNG或EPS)以适应不同平台的应用。 “200个矢量箭头图标”提供了丰富的设计灵感与工具,无论是初学者还是资深设计师都能从中受益。通过提高工作效率和增强作品的专业感及吸引力,“200个矢量箭头图标”的实用性显而易见,并能够满足多样化的设计需求,为创意工作带来更多的便利性。
  • Quiver 5:使用真实3D绘制-MATLAB
    优质
    Quiver 5是一款用于MATLAB环境下的工具箱,它能够利用真实的3D箭头来直观地展示和分析向量场数据,为科研及工程领域提供强大的可视化支持。 在MATLAB编程环境中,Quiver 5是一个扩展工具,它提供了改进的3D箭头绘制功能,尤其适用于科学可视化。这个工具基于MATLAB内置的`quiver3`函数,但通过一些定制和优化,能更好地呈现三维箭头的效果,使用户能够更直观地理解流体动力学、电磁场或其他涉及向量场的数据。 `quiver3`函数是MATLAB中用于在三维空间中绘制向量场的标准命令。它接受x、y、z、u、v、w这六个参数,分别代表箭头的位置坐标和方向分量。例如,`quiver3(x, y, z, u, v, w)`会在三维空间中的每个(x, y, z)位置上绘制一个箭头,箭头的方向由(u, v, w)决定。然而,原版的`quiver3`函数在表示箭头时可能会有些局限,比如箭头的形状和比例可能无法满足复杂场景的需求。 Quiver 5的改进主要体现在以下几个方面: 1. **箭头样式**:包含更丰富的箭头样式选择,如箭头头部的形状、尾部的设计以及透明度调整,使得箭头更具视觉吸引力且符合实际应用需求。 2. **箭头长度比例**:提供了更好的方法来控制箭头的长度,使其可以根据向量的大小动态调整,从而更准确地反映数据的强度。 3. **3D效果增强**:通过优化渲染技术,在三维空间中更好地体现箭头的真实感和立体性,帮助观察者理解空间中的流向。 4. **颜色映射**:支持根据向量的大小或方向使用颜色映射,使数据可视化更加直观。例如,可以根据向量大小调整箭头的颜色或者依据其方向改变颜色。 5. **交互性**:增加了旋转、缩放和平移视图的功能,允许用户从不同角度查看和理解向量场。 6. **自定义参数**:提供了更多的定制选项,包括调整箭头的粗细、间隔及与轴的比例等设置以适应不同的可视化需求。 压缩包quiver5.zip中可能包含以下内容: 1. **源代码**:实现Quiver 5功能的相关MATLAB脚本或函数。 2. **示例数据**:用于演示Quiver 5特性的3D向量场数据集。 3. **使用指南**:详细说明如何利用新功能和调用相关函数的文档材料。 4. **示例脚本**:展示在MATLAB环境中如何应用Quiver 5的具体案例。 通过学习和运用Quiver 5,用户可以提升其三维向量场可视化能力,在科学研究、工程分析及教学演示等领域获得更加生动且精确的数据表示方法。此工具有助于更深入地理解和解释复杂的物理现象。
  • 插件arrow.mMATLAB新版
    优质
    arrow.m是一款专为MATLAB设计的新版箭头图生成插件,它能够帮助用户轻松绘制高质量、自定义化的矢量图形,极大提升了数据可视化效率。 针对高版本MATLAB加载BNT工具时出现的无法绘制箭头的问题,可以更新..\FullBNT-1.0.4.zip\FullBNT-1.0.4\GraphViz 文件夹中的arrow.m文件,并将其重命名为arrow.m以替换原有文件。
  • Quiver Rotate:调整由 quiver() 函数方向 - MATLAB
    优质
    本MATLAB资源提供了一个函数,用于修正quiver()绘制的向量箭头的方向问题,确保矢量场可视化更加准确和直观。 使用 `quiver()` 生成的箭袋中的箭头可以绕其 (x,y) 底部旋转任意指定的角度(以度或弧度为单位)。例如: - 执行 `h = quiver(X, Y, U, V)` 后,`quiverRotate(h)` 将现有箭头旋转180度。 - 使用 `quiverRotate(h, r)` 可将现有箭头按r弧度进行旋转。 - 命令 `quiverRotate(h, d, deg)` 则可以将现有箭头以d度为单位来旋转。 此外,还可以通过以下方式计算矢量分量: - 执行 `[Ur, Vr] = quiverRotate(U, V)` 将得到180度旋转的矢量分量。 - 使用 `[Ur, Vr] = quiverRotate(U, V, r)` 可获得按弧度r旋转后的矢量分量。 - 命令 `[Ur, Vr] = quiverRotate(U, V, d, deg)` 则能计算出以d度为单位旋转的矢量分量。 最后,可以使用新的向量分量 (X,Y,Ur,Vr) 来重新绘制箭袋。
  • MACD指标
    优质
    “MACD带箭头指标”是一种在技术分析中广泛使用的工具,通过结合移动平均线和指数平滑算法来识别股票趋势。箭头信号帮助交易者明确买卖时机,简化了图表解读过程。 MACD指标方便使用且能明确方向,是一个经典的技术分析工具,值得采纳!
  • ::rocket:推力控制模型火
    优质
    本项目为一款教育性质的模拟软件,专注于推力矢量控制原理及其在火箭操控中的应用。通过交互式学习体验,用户可以深入了解和实践复杂的飞行轨迹调整技术。 该资料库包含由扎卡里·科嫩(Zachary Kohnen)设计的火箭模型。这些火箭采用基于主动推力矢量控制(TVC)的稳定装置。每个型号的信息可以在提供的目录中找到,包括各个项目的飞行固件详情。 以下是部分火箭列表及其基本信息: 执照 Thrust Vector Controlled Model Rockets Copyright (C) 2020 Zachary Kohnen (DusterTheFirst) 本程序是自由软件:您可以在GPL许可协议的条款下重新发布和/或修改它。
  • MATLAB场绘绘制
    优质
    本文介绍了在MATLAB中如何进行向量场的可视化,包括绘制二维和三维空间内的箭头图,帮助读者掌握使用quiver函数及相关技巧来展示复杂数据集中的方向和速度信息。 在MATLAB中绘制向量场图或箭头图的方法是通过使用quiver函数。该函数允许用户指定数据点的坐标、每个点上的向量分量,并可选择性地设置颜色和其他样式选项,以可视化二维空间中的向量分布情况。这种方法对于分析流体动力学问题、电磁场等科学和工程领域的问题非常有用。
  • MATLAB三维线段绘函数
    优质
    本篇文章介绍了在MATLAB中绘制三维带箭头线段的方法和技巧,帮助用户掌握相关函数的使用。适合需要进行复杂图形展示的研究者和技术人员阅读。 函数功能:输入线段的两个端点p1和p2的三维坐标,例如[px1,py1,pz1;px2,py2,pz2],绘制从p1到p2的连线,并在p2处绘制由p1指向p2的箭头。箭头的宽度和长度与线段的距离成比例。